What this book is about
The twelfth Dresden Files novel is the series' most dramatic turning point. Harry Dresden learns he has a daughter — and she has been kidnapped by the Red Court vampires. What follows is the most violent, highest-stakes, and most emotionally devastating installment in the series: Harry makes choices he cannot uncross, beloved characters die, and the Red Court's war with the White Council is resolved in a way that permanently and shockingly alters the series' landscape. Butcher holds nothing back.
